Philadelphia Swim Club is planning for the coming year. Investors would like to earn a 10% return on the company's $37,000,000 of assets. The company primarily incurs fixed costs to maintain the swimming pool. Fixed costs are projected to be $12,600,000 for the year. About 540,000 members are expected to swim each year. Variable costs are about $13 per swimmer. The Philadelphia Swim Club has a favorable reputation in the area and therefore, has some control over the membership price. Using a cost-plus approach, what price should Philadelphia Swim Club charge for a membership?


A) $43.19
B) $36.33
C) $29.48
D) $6.85
